Fragrant vermouths and elegant wines under the Marengo brand are produced at the Koblevo winery, which borders the popular resort of Mykolaiv region.

The company is owned by Bayadera Group, one of the strongest players in the Ukrainian alcohol market.

The history of the Marengo brand

The first bottle of vermouth with the name "the color of the sea wave" was released in 2001. The date indicated on the product packaging - 1982 - corresponds to the time of the founding of the winery in Koblevo.

It took about 20 years to create a harmonious recipe. The company has been experimenting with ingredients for a long time, combining various European grape varieties with aromatic herbs and spices. The result is a perfectly balanced, refined vermouth made from high quality wine.

In just a few years, the Marengo brand won the love of consumers and became the No. 1 vermouth in Ukraine.

In 2015, the trademark was expanded with a line of refreshing sparkling wines based on nutmeg grape varieties.

Within 5 months, the new champagne became the second best-selling wine in Ukraine.

In 2018, low-alcohol cocktails with the addition of Italian orange and still wines appeared in the Marengo collection.

In 2019, the design of Marengo vermouths was updated as a result of the joint work of the international agencies Reynolds and Reyner and Lewis Moberly. After the restyling, the bottle has become more elegant and stylish: the label has a metallic sheen, the font has become more effective, and the blue and gold cap has a coat of arms.

Specifics of production

The company buys grape vines in Europe (Italy, France, Germany), carefully selecting seedlings of elite varieties. For varietal wines, raw materials are harvested exclusively by hand, for canteens - with the help of French Gregoire harvesters.

The Koblevo plant uses innovative equipment from leading Italian, French, and Japanese companies to produce beverages: Della Toffola, Fabbri-Inox, Daikin, Bertolaso. All stages of production (from grape growing to production) are controlled by Italian oenologists.

Italian traditions and technologies were used to develop the vermouth recipe.

The drinks include up to 11 natural herbs, flowers and spices. The ingredients include: essential oil rose, sage, coriander, lavender, lemon balm, wormwood, chamomile, immortelle, nutmeg, vanilla.

Collection of dessert vermouths "Marengo"

  1. Classic Bianco

    Classic white vermouth with a stylish, harmonious, emotional character.

    The bouquet combines softness and sweetness with bright notes of fragrant herbs. A great choice for noisy companies and parties.

    Can be consumed as a standalone drink on the rocks and as a component of light cocktails. Harmonizes with desserts and fruits.

    Marengo Classic Bianco

  2. Classic Rosso

    Seductive vermouth of deep pink color with a passionate, explosive bouquet enveloping in soft sweetness.

    The best choice for a bachelorette party. Good on ice, in cocktails, in combination with nuts, bitter chocolate, cheeses, fruits, desserts.

    Marengo Classic Rosso

  3. Bianco Dry

    Dry vermouth with a moderately tart taste, delicate aroma and sensual, refined character.

    Suitable for atmospheric friendly meetings. Recommended to be combined with ice, olives, citrus fruits, hard cheeses.

    Perfectly complements classic cocktails.

    Marengo Dry

  4. Sea Breeze

    A fresh, exotic, refined drink in which minty coolness is combined with subtle spicy notes of ginger.

    Good for creating a summer mood. Can be consumed on its own with ice, as part of light cocktails, paired with desserts and fruits.

    Marengo Sea Breeze

  5. Special

    A special vermouth with a refined, rich character and a festive spicy vanilla aroma. Will be a good addition to exclusive parties.

    Best enjoyed neat or in the company of ice.

  6. Mojito

    A refreshing, tonic drink that combines minty coolness, citrus aroma and light sweetness.

    Ideal for the summer season and beach parties. Good as a base ingredient for simple cocktails with ice and soda.

    Goes well with fruits and light desserts.

The strength of vermouths is 15-16%. The optimal serving temperature: 10-15 °C.

Collection of sparkling wines "Marengo"

  1. Brut

    A refined product with a pleasant refreshing taste and elegant floral aroma. Serving temperature: 7-9 °C.

    Marengo Brut

  2. Semi-Sweet

    Exquisite semi-sweet wine with a fruity bouquet and soft muscat aroma. Serving temperature: 10-15 °C.

    Marengo Semi-Sweet

  3. Semi-Dry

    Light semi-dry champagne with a delicate refreshing taste and delicate floral aroma. Suitable for special occasions and creating a romantic mood. Serving temperature: 8-14 °C.

    Marengo Semi-Dry

  4. Rose

    Luxurious pink semi-sweet wine with a bright fruity taste and floral and berry aroma. Serving temperature: 8-14 °C.

    Marengo Rose

  5. Sweet

    Sweet sparkling wine with a rich floral and fruity bouquet. Serving temperature: 12-15 °C.

    Marengo Sweet

Marengo still wine line

Includes 7 drinks with a strength of 13% based on popular European grape varieties: dry red Cabernet, semi-sweet pink Nuvole Rosa, semi-sweet red Diamante Nero, dry white Chardonnay and Pinot Grigio, semi-sweet white Moscato Delicious and Di Fiore.

Interesting facts

  1. The Koblevo winery is located at the same geographical latitude as the French Beaujolais region, which provides optimal conditions for growing vines. It is not surprising that the largest number of Ukrainian vineyards is concentrated here: the total area reaches 2.5 thousand hectares.

  2. Among the partners of the Bayadera Group holding are the world's largest companies: Remy Cointreau, Moët Hennessy, Mast - Jägermeister, Proximo Spirits, Diageo.

  3. The unusual blue color of the sparkling cocktail Lazzurro is of absolutely natural origin: it is obtained with the help of grape skin extract.
